The Portis domino is the first thing to watch for and is actually kind of important. He is under contract for 3.8M for one year if he opts in, but he is probably looking to capitalize on a multiple year deal after shooting 47% from 3 this past season. If he opts out, probably the only way the Bucks can re-sign him is to use their 5.8M mid-level exception and would not be surprised if that is what his agent is eyeballing. The problem for the Bucks in that scenario is that they lose the 5.8M exception to sign an outside player to add a veteran to strengthen their bench play. 

As others have stated the Bucks do not have much for tradeable assets to make much of a splash. DiVincenzo is one piece that does have some trade value, but personally I would like to see the Bucks keep him because of his upside potential. 

Perfect world, IMHO, would be Portis opting in, the Bucks using the mid-level to add a versatile 4/5 like Kelly Olynyk or a true veteran PG like TJ McConnell (very wishful thinking) to pair with or spell Holiday at times. 

The Bucks also have 2 trade exceptions that they can use before February, so an in season trade or two for a veteran roll player like Tucker is also something to keep in mind as the season goes on.
